Benis, as part of this province, benefits from and contributes to its broader regional identity.Precise Coordinates and Location
For those who appreciate geographical precision, Benis offers clear markers. The village is situated in Shabestar County, within the East Azerbaijan Province of Iran. Its exact geographical coordinates are 38.2090726 latitude and 45.7283577 longitude. To put this into a more traditional format, its coordinates are 38° 12' 52" North and 45° 43' 42" East. The original name of the village, complete with diacritics, is "benīs." The climate of Benis, Iran, like much of the East Azerbaijan Province, is characterized by distinct seasons, ranging from hot summers to cold, snowy winters. Understanding these climatic variations is essential, as they significantly influence local agriculture, daily life, and even the architectural styles found within the village. The data provides specific insights into the weather patterns across different months, painting a vivid picture of the village's seasonal changes.Autumnal Charms: October and November
Autumn in Benis is described as an enjoyable period, with pleasant temperatures. In October, the average temperature ranges between a maximum of 17.1°C (62.8°F) and a minimum of 7.9°C (46.2°F). This moderate climate makes October, similar to September, an ideal time for outdoor activities and agricultural harvesting. Rainfall is present but not excessive, with rain falling for approximately 10.1 days and accumulating up to 22mm (0.87 inches) of precipitation. Moving into November, the temperatures begin to drop further, signaling the approach of winter. During November, the rain falls for 8.3 days, regularly aggregating up to 24mm (0.94 inches) of precipitation. Snowfall also makes its appearance, with approximately 12mm (0.47 inches) of snow typically accumulated over 1.9 snowfall days. These months represent a transitional period, offering a mix of crisp air, colorful foliage, and the first hints of winter's chill.Winter Wonderland: January
January stands out as the coldest and snowiest month in Benis, Iran. It is when the village truly transforms into a winter wonderland, often blanketed in snow. The data indicates that January is the month with the most snowfall, with snow falling for 10.5 days and typically aggregating up to a substantial 184mm (7.24 inches) of snow. This heavy snowfall not only creates picturesque landscapes but also impacts transportation and daily routines, requiring residents to adapt to the colder conditions. The winter months are a crucial period for water replenishment in the region, with snowmelt feeding rivers and underground water sources that sustain agriculture and communities throughout the year.Summer Sizzle: July
In stark contrast to the cold winters, July in Benis, like June, is a moderately hot summer month. The average temperature during July varies between a low of 17.8°C (64°F) and a high of 29.6°C (85.3°F). July is identified as the warmest month, with temperatures averaging a high of 29.6°C (85.3°F). Beyond its geographical and social fabric, Benis holds a notable place in Iran's economic history, particularly within the confectionery industry. The story of the "Benis factory" is a testament to entrepreneurial spirit and innovation originating from this very village. "The story of the birth of Benis factory, begins many years ago when 'Haj Mirza Agha Rasoulavi Benis', for creating a large business in the field of cake, cookie and chocolate products in our country, took action." This historical account positions a figure named Haj Mirza Agha Rasoulavi Benis as a pioneering force, often referred to as the "father of Iranian cake."
